    Dear members,

    Just for your information. I may be wrong, but it appeared to me that members had indicated that the AVK test version does not allow definition updates during the 30 day period. Indeed, in the past, this was stated on GData's website in relation to test versions. Upon noticing that this statement has disappeared from their website, I wondered if the latest trials do allow updates throughout the test period. Accordingly, I have contacted GData to confirm this. Their reply:

    Of course the trial-version of AntiVirusKit 2007 includes the updates of the virus-definitions for the whole period.
